Transaction 2cd6ebc8ba5920ffc99476656e1a93811044383611e00954480ff3945ea406b3

8 Input
2 Outputs
  • 2cd6ebc8ba5920ffc99476656e1a93811044383611e00954480ff3945ea406b3:0
  • value  264000000
    address  1PwL7TWHD456sojMPLUsS8Sd97J8rBhsvy
  • 2cd6ebc8ba5920ffc99476656e1a93811044383611e00954480ff3945ea406b3:1
  • value  431130801
    address  14LFGvPPnfVqygX5SXnrA9KTCJFyzFMGEs